Flash DELL PERC H200I to LSI SAS HBA 9211-81 and Use it in the Integrated Slot on an R410, R510, R610, R710 or R810

by Simon Sparks · 13 April 2020

From a bootable MS-DOS USB Memory Stick

SAS2FLSH.EXE-listall
SAS2FLSH.EXE-c0-list

Note down the SAS address in case something goes wrong and you need to reprogram the SAS address.

Erase the old firmware and boot ROM

SAS2FLSH.EXE-o-e6

Write the Dell 6Gbps firmware

SAS2FLSH.EXE-o-f6GBPSAS.FW

Write the LSI P07 firmware

SAS2FLSH.EXE-o-fP07-2118it.bin


Write the LSI P20 firmware

SAS2FLSH.EXE-o-fP20-2118it.bin
